1. Usage Boiling Water
When faced with a clogged up sink, the first thing you need to attempt is to put boiling water down the drain. That has to do with one of the most simple solution to blocked sinks as well as drains. Boiling water helps counteract the bits and also particles causing the obstruction, especially if it's oil, oil, or soap bits, as well as in many cases, it can flush it all down, as well as your sink will certainly be back to normal.
Do not attempt this method if you have plastic pipelines (PVC) because warm water might melt the lines and also trigger even more damage. If you utilize plastic pipes, you may want to stick to using a bettor to obtain debris out.
Using this method, activate the tap to see how water flows after putting warm water down the tubes. If the blockage lingers, try the process again. Nonetheless, the clog could be a lot more relentless in some cases as well as call for more than just boiling water.

4. Sodium Bicarbonate as well as Vinegar
As opposed to using any type of form of chemicals or bleach, this method is safer as well as not harmful to you or your sink. Baking soda and vinegar are daily residence things utilized for many other things, and also they can do the technique to your kitchen area sink.
Firstly, eliminate any type of water that is left in the sink with a cup.
Then put a great amount of baking soft drink away.
Pour in one mug of vinegar.
Seal the water drainage opening and also allow it to settle for some minutes.
Pour hot water away to dissolve various other persistent deposit and fragments.
Following this straightforward approach can suffice, as well as you can have your kitchen sink back. Repeat the process as much as you consider necessary to free the sink of this particles entirely.

How to Unclog a Kitchen Sink
Take the Plunge
Start your efforts by plunging. Use a plunger with a large rubber bell and a sturdy handle. Before getting to work on the drain, clamp the drain line to the dishwasher. If you don t close the line, plunging could force dirty water into the dishwasher.
Fill the sink with several inches of water. This ensures a good seal over the drain.
If you have a double sink, plug the other drain with a wet rag or strainer.
Insert the plunger at an angle, making sure water, not air, fills the bell.
Plunge forcefully several times. Pop off the plunger.
Repeat plunging and popping several times until the water drains.Clean the Trap
The P-trap is the curved pipe under the sink. The trap arm is the straight pipe that attaches to the P-trap and runs to the drain stub-out on the wall. Grease and debris can block this section of pipe. Here s how to unclog a kitchen sink by cleaning out the trap:
Remove as much standing water from the sink as possible.
Place a bucket under the pipe to catch the water as it drains.
Unscrew the slip nuts at both ends of the P-trap. Use slip-joint pliers and work carefully to avoid damaging the pipes or fasteners.
If you find a clog, remove it. Reassemble the trap.
If the P-trap isn t clogged, remove the trap arm and look for clogs there. Run the tip of a screwdriver into the drain stub-out to fetch nearby gunk.Spin the Auger
With the trap disassembled, you re ready to crank the auger down the drain line.
Pull a 12-inch length of cable from the auger and tighten the setscrew.
Insert the auger into the drain line, easing it into the pipe.
Feed the cable into the line until you feel an obstruction. Pull out more cable if you need to.
If you come to a clog, crank and push the cable until you feel it break through. The cable will lose tension when this happens.
Crank counterclockwise to pull out the cable, catching the grime and debris with a rag as the cable retracts.
